Juan Song is a scholar working on Computer Vision and Pattern Recognition, Artificial Intelligence and Human-Computer Interaction. According to data from OpenAlex, Juan Song has authored 60 papers receiving a total of 1.3k indexed citations (citations by other indexed papers that have themselves been cited), including 29 papers in Computer Vision and Pattern Recognition, 10 papers in Artificial Intelligence and 6 papers in Human-Computer Interaction. Recurrent topics in Juan Song’s work include Human Pose and Action Recognition (7 papers), Gesture Recognition in Human-Computer Interaction (6 papers) and Advanced Image and Video Retrieval Techniques (5 papers). Juan Song is often cited by papers focused on Human Pose and Action Recognition (7 papers), Gesture Recognition in Human-Computer Interaction (6 papers) and Advanced Image and Video Retrieval Techniques (5 papers). Juan Song collaborates with scholars based in China, Australia and United States. Juan Song's co-authors include Peiyi Shen, Liang Zhang, Guangming Zhu, Justin Tan, Zhenjun Tang, Xianquan Zhang, Shengmei Zhou, Michael C. Fishbein, Masahiro Ogawa and Peng‐Sheng Chen and has published in prestigious journals such as Circulation, ACS Catalysis and Journal of International Business Studies.
